Corn prices in the southern African nation began falling after farmers planted 18 per cent more of the crop before this years harvest, the Famine Early Warning Systems Network, partly funded by USAID, said 12 May.
Zimbabwe is expected to produce about 1.3 million tons of corn in 2014-15, up from 800,000 tons in 2013-14, according to the U.S. Department of Agriculture.
